正确调用帝国CMS内置函数需先引入核心文件,如connect.php或config.php,确保路径正确;常用函数包括db_query、sys_ReturnBqClassname、printerror等,依赖全局变量时需注意环境初始化;在自定义页面中应通过$empire对象操作数据库,并使用RepPostStr、htmlspecialchars等函数过滤输入输出;可将公共函数封装至userfun.php实现复用,避免命名冲突。规范引入、安全过滤与合理封装是高效二次开发的关键。

在进行帝国CMS二次开发时,正确调用系统内置函数不仅能提高开发效率,还能保证程序的稳定性与安全性。帝国CMS(EmpireCMS)本身封装了大量实用的函数库,涵盖数据库操作、页面生成、用户权限、数据处理等多个方面。掌握这些内置函数的调用方式,是高效开发的基础。
在自定义PHP文件或插件中使用帝国CMS内置函数前,必须先引入系统核心文件,否则会提示函数未定义。
帝国CMS提供丰富的功能函数,以下为高频使用的几类:
调用时注意参数是否必填,部分函数依赖全局变量(如$class_r、$public_r)。
若在e/extend/或自建目录下开发,需手动初始化环境。
可将常用逻辑封装成函数,放入e/class/userfun.php中。
基本上就这些。只要正确引入环境、规范调用、注意安全过滤,就能顺畅使用帝国CMS的内置函数进行二次开发。不复杂但容易忽略路径和全局变量依赖问题。
以上就是帝国cms二次开发时如何正确调用内置函数_帝国cms二次开发内置函数调用方法的详细内容,更多请关注php中文网其它相关文章!
                        
                        每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
                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号